Default 05 tc cai on 09 tc

Is there anyway to make a cold air intake that is made for the 05-06 tc fit on a 09 tc. it is the fujita cai.

You'd have to do some custom fabbing. The MAF flanges are different.

You'd be better off just getting a CAI for the correct year.

Bro...hit me up with a PM.... I actually made a solid patch for mine doing the same thing. I took all the mods off my 06 tC before I sold it and installed them on my new 08 tC. and one of those parts was an 06 Injen CAI
If you're serious about buying that one...then PM me...and the cost is dirt cheap for the CAI...b/c in order to make it work you WILL need a MAF sensor off of an 05-06 tC. Which generally isnt cheap. I happened to have one b/c I was making the switch on both tC's at the same time. This swap mod can be done...but unless you're getting the part cheaper than hell....listen to the rest on here and buy the correct one for your year of tC. You will have a lot less headaches.

Well just for kicks I installed the 05-06 Fujita CAI on my 09 tC and used the MAF adapter from randode.com. Everything lined up and installed just fine except the mounting bracket was about an inch off. I drove about 200 miles on it and never got a CEL. It sounds amazing and can feel some more lower end power. So this setup will work if you dont mind drilling a new hole for mounting purposes.
